What exactly is a 15×30 pergola? It’s a substantial overhead structure, typically supported by posts, that defines a vast outdoor room. Measuring ​​15 feet wide by 30 feet long (approximately 4.6m x 9.1m)​​, it provides a generous ​​450 square feet​​ of covered space. This footprint is unparalleled for hosting large gatherings, creating a multi-functional family zone, or even constructing a stunning poolside cabana retreat. Unlike a solid-roof gazebo, many pergolas feature open beams or adjustable louvers that offer a perfect blend of sun and shade, allowing for air circulation and a connection with the outdoors .

🛠️ Key Considerations for a Grand Structure

A project of this magnitude requires careful planning. Here’s what you must think about:

​• Material Choice is Crucial:​

  • ​Wood (Cedar, Redwood):​​ Offers a classic, natural beauty and can be stained to any color. However, it requires ​​ongoing maintenance​​ like staining and sealing to prevent weathering and rot .

  • ​Aluminum:​​ The modern low-maintenance champion. ​​Powder-coated aluminum​​ is lightweight, rust-resistant, and incredibly durable. Many high-end aluminum pergolas feature ​​motorized louvered roofs​​ for ultimate control over sun and rain .

  • ​Vinyl:​​ Extremely low-maintenance and durable, but may lack the natural aesthetic of wood and the sleekness of metal.

​• Roof Options Define Functionality:​

  • ​Open-Beam:​​ Traditional and beautiful, offering dappled shade. Perfect for climbing plants like wisteria.

  • ​Fixed Solid Roof:​​ Provides complete protection from sun and rain, making it more like a pavilion.

  • ​Retractable Canopy:​​ Offers flexibility to adjust shade as needed.

  • ​Motorized Louvers:​​ The premium choice. ​​Adjustable aluminum louvers​​ let you fine-tune the sunlight and provide waterproof protection when closed, often with integrated hidden drainage .

​• Permits and Professional Installation are a Must:​​ Due to its large size, ​​checking local building codes and obtaining permits is essential​​. Professional installation is highly recommended to ensure the structure is perfectly level, securely anchored, and built to withstand wind and snow loads. This is not typically a DIY project for most homeowners .

💰 Investment and Budgeting

A 15×30 pergola is a significant investment in your home and lifestyle. Costs can vary dramatically based on materials, roof system, and labor.

  • ​Prefabricated Kits:​​ Might range from ​5,000to15,000+​​ for the materials alone.

  • ​Custom-Built (Professional Installation):​​ This is where you can expect the highest quality and price. A custom wood or high-end aluminum pergola with a motorized roof can range from ​20,000to40,000 or more​​ installed .

  • ​Budget Factors:​​ Remember to factor in costs for ​​site preparation, electrical work​​ (for lighting and outlets), and ​​furnishings​​.

🔧 Maintenance for Longevity

Your maintenance routine will depend heavily on your material choice:

  • ​Wood:​​ Requires the most upkeep. Plan on ​​annual inspections and cleaning, with re-staining or sealing every 2-3 years​​ to protect it from the elements .

  • ​Aluminum/Vinyl:​​ Incredibly low maintenance. Typically, an ​​annual wash with soap and water​​ is all that’s needed to keep it looking new. Inspect moving parts (like louvers) periodically as recommended by the manufacturer .
